The embodiment of the invention belongs to the technical field of intelligent traffic management and control, and relates to a road three-dimensional model construction method and device, computer equipment and a storage medium, and the method comprises the steps: obtaining point cloud data through employing a laser radar technology while collecting GNSS data, and achieving the combined processing of the two through employing a deep learning technology, therefore, the accuracy and robustness of the data are improved; based on real-time fusion of multi-source data, a dynamic road model is generated, and the perception ability of the system to the road environment is enhanced; the constructed high-precision dynamic three-dimensional model can realize real-time tracking and prediction of a dynamic object, provides accurate environmental understanding and future motion inference for a system, and is suitable for more complex scenes.
